China’s Transsion Holdings, the firm that makes Tecno and other low priced smartphones has been accused of selling handsets with pre-installed software that drains mobile data.
Since releasing its first smartphone in 2014, the upstart has grown to become Africa’s top handset seller, beating out long-time market leaders such as Samsung and Nokia.
Tecno Mobile dominates Africa’s smartphone market with a 41 per cent share, according to market research firm IDC…
